How Did FitVine Come About?
FitVine Wine was born when friends made a pact to craft amazing wines that also fit their lifestyles. Our team is always on the go, whether we’re doing high intensity workouts, cycling, running, skiing, paddle boarding, or just enjoying the outdoors. We set about combining our love for wine and fitness with an ethic for sustainability.
Our Fermentation Process.
To create wines that are clean tasting and rich in flavor and mouthfeel, our wines go through an extended fermentation process. We ferment to dry, lowering sugar levels, which is why our wines average less than 1.0g of sugar per liter or ~0.01g - 0.09g per 5oz glass. As of July 2018, we have updated our nutritional info to account for a 5 oz sample size compared to a 4 oz size, which is what we listed in the past. The updated information is below and will soon be reflected on bottle labels for our products. Here are the breakdowns per varietal:
Cabernet Sauvignon average analysis per 5oz glass @ 14.1% alcohol:
0.06g of sugar, 117 calories, 3.9g of carbohydrates
Pinot Noir average analysis per 5oz glass @ 13.9% alcohol:
0.03g of sugar, 118 calories, 3.7g of carbohydrates
Rose average analysis per 5oz glass @ 12.4% alcohol:
0.09g of sugar, 112 calories, 2.8g of carbohydrates
Chardonnay average analysis per 5oz glass @ 13.4% alcohol:
0.04g of sugar, 115 calories, 2.5g of carbohydrates
Pinot Grigio average analysis per 5oz glass @ 13.4% alcohol:
0.09g of sugar, 109 calories, 2.5g of carbohydrates
Sauvignon Blanc average analysis per 5oz glass @ 13.4% alcohol:
0.09g of sugar, 114 calories, 2.7g of carbohydrates
Holiday Red Blend average analysis per 5oz glass @ 13.9% alcohol:
0.01g of sugar, 120 calories, 3.5g of carbohydrates
Not only does our proprietary process allow us to extract more color and tannins, we also filter all of our wines with both diatomaceous earth and micron pads so they are gluten free and vegan friendly. Our wines contain sulfites at <35 ppm (parts per million).
Our Grapes
We are very picky when selecting grapes. We choose only the highest quality grapes from small farmers who focus on quality, not quantity. Our story doesn’t include fancy chateaus or barrels hewed from the limbs of majestic oaks. We’re OK with that and we think you will be too.
